Definitions:

Biological Community

An assemblage of different species of organisms living together in a particular area, interacting with each other within their environment.

Environment

Refers to the surrounding conditions and factors that affect living organisms, including natural and man-made elements.

Species

Unique type of organism designated by genus name and specific epithet. Of sexual reproducers, often defined as one or more groups of individuals that can potentially interbreed, produce fertile offspring, and do not interbreed with other groups.

Population

A group of organisms of the same species who live in a specific location and breed with one another more often than they breed with members of other populations.
